Design of mobile chipper
Svoboda, Tomáš ; Šuranský, Michal (referee) ; Brandejs, Jan (advisor)
The Bachelor thesis deals with the structural design of a mobile chipper that uses mass-produced compact tractors VARI as its energy sources. This Bachelor thesis is divided into four main chapters: a description of the basic technology used for processing natural materials that is characteristic of this type of equipment, the current state of structural details of compact tractors VARI and their equipment, a detailed study of technical aspects of the compact tractor providing the power, various drafts of possible solutions with a presentation of a functional home-made prototype, and a detailed description of the final version of the design. The thesis also includes an approximate calculation of the maximal possible diameter of the processed material and a technical drawing.
The engine of a tractor
Mátyás, Attila ; Sedláček, Martin (referee) ; Kašpárek, Jaroslav (advisor)
This thesis deals with the design and selection of a small utility tractor engine unit. The first theoretical part briefly describes tractors with similar weight category, provides an overview of existing tractor brands and their comparison. The second part of this thesis consists of analytical calculations based on the provided parameters of the tractor. Total power will be the sum of the individual power required for the various technical operations during functioning. The last part deals with selecting the suitable engine unit from the available brochures of world manufacturers based on the calculated values.
Design of mini backhoe
John, Václav ; Bilík, Martin (referee) ; Pavlík, Jan (advisor)
Main goal of this bachelor thesis is design of a backhoe for a compact tractor. First part of this thesis describes principle of the backhoe. In the second part different design solutions for each component are considered. In the third part basic design calculations are described. Last part shows models of components for chosen design solution.
